Make the most of our database
A bit of information about V-base and how it works;
V-base is a database holding volunteering opportunities and contact data. This allows potential volunteers to search and browse volunteering options. The database is compiled and maintained by Volunteer Centre staff and registration is free. Volunteering opportunities registered on V-base are also posted online nationally at www.do-it.org.uk
How to give your volunteering opportunities maximum impact;
The database is only as accurate as the information entered.
Please let us know:
-
if there are any changes to your contact details
-
if specific volunteering roles have been filled
-
if there are any new volunteering opportunities
Organisations can also have the details of their opportunities temporarily “hidden” on the database if, for example, they are currently filled.
Database entries are also time-specific and when expired will need to be renewed by organisations. In practice, the Volunteer Centre staff would normally contact organisations to review the entries and make any necessary changes but it is good idea to keep in regular touch with your Volunteer Centre about the opportunities available.
